NONWOVEN FABRICS FOR HVAC MARKET OVERVIEW

The Nonwoven Fabrics for HVAC Market size was valued at USD 1.91 bill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 3.1 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.2% from 2024 to 2032.

HVAC nonwoven is a very specialized sector that works on the production of fabrics meant specifically for he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ems. Such kinds of fabrics are typically valuable in air filtration uses and provide more advantages in terms of durability, cost-effectiveness, and efficient maintenance of air quality. These fabrics are used increasingly in residential, commercial, and industrial HVAC because of their lightweight characteristics, ease of management, and improvement of air filtration systems. The market is continuously growing owing to the increased concerns for indoor air quality, energy efficiency, and environmental standards, and the innovations in nonwoven fabrics are innovatively continuously improving with performance improvements focused on reduced energy consumption and more sustainable solutions. Thus, they are an important component of modern HVACs with long benefits in terms of air quality, operational efficiency, and environmental aspects.

NONWOVEN FABRICS FOR HVAC MARKET SEGMENTATION

By Type

Based on Type, the global market can be categorized into PP Non-woven Fabric & Polyester Non-woven Fabric

  • PP Non-woven Fabric: Lightweight, durable, and good in filtration, these non-woven polypropylene (PP) fabrics would be widely applied for HVAC systems. They resist moisture, chemicals, and high temperatures and cater to different environmental conditions. Very economical and recyclable, they are going to add to the advantage of using a modern HVAC application.
  • Polyester Non-woven Fabric: The strength and elasticity define the ability of polyester non-woven fabrics, along with some abrasion resistance, making them serve reliable performance in HVAC filters. Such high-performance systems can filter fine particles yet permit good airflow, and the recycled material would match the current trend for greener HVAC solutions.

By Application

Based on application, the global market can be categorized into Car Air Conditioning System, Home Air Conditioning System & Commercial Air Conditioning System

  • Car Air Conditioning System: Nonwovens in car air conditioning systems make the cabin air cleaner by filtering dust, allergens, and pollutants well. They are also very light and compact, fitting well into the constrained spaces of vehicles while also keeping very high filtration efficiency. The ongoing trend towards top-quality air filtration in automobiles drives its adoption for the automotive HVAC market.
  • Home Air Conditioning Systems: Nonwoven fabrics ensure cleaner air at home, trapping fine particles such as dust, pollen, and pet dander indoors. Improved energy efficiency is made possible through the maintained constant airflow while increasing the longevity of the filter. Greater awareness of indoor air quality will sharpen their use in places like homes.
  • Commercial Air Conditioning System: Nonwoven fabrics in the commercial air conditioning systems are used with high air volumes, filtering air for improved indoor air quality within offices, malls, and industrial spaces. The tough construction of these filters helps withstand prolonged use and efficiently filters the atmospheric pollutants and microbial contaminants. Urbanization and the need for effective HVAC systems increase their use in the commercial segment.

Restraining Factor

Market growth is hindered by input price volatility and costs

Price volatility of inputs such as polypropylene and polyester highly hinders this market. Crude oil prices, the major input for all synthetic fibers, fluctuate, which in turn makes a direct impact on production costs. This increase, in turn, raises these overall costs, making these filters costlier and therefore limiting them much, particularly in cost-sensitive regions.

Challenge

Market growth faces challenges from nonwoven disposal and sustainability concerns

One of the critical challenges for the nonwoven fabrics for the HVAC market is the neglect of how fabric is disposed of. Nonwoven fabrics are primarily made of synthetic materials like polypropylene and polyester that are not biodegradable, raising concerns with respect to waste management and sustainability. Therefore, the pressure on manufacturers to implement eco-friendly alternatives has increased. Balancing performance with eco-responsibility is one of the main challenges facing the industry.

KEY INDUSTRY DEVELOPMENT

October 2023: Freudenberg Performance Materials introduced an advanced range of nonwoven filter media specifically designed for HVAC systems to enhance air quality and energy efficiency. The new product line incorporates cutting-edge nanofiber technology, offering superior filtration efficiency while reducing pressure drop, which helps in lowering energy consumption. These nonwoven fabrics are also lightweight, durable, and resistant to microbial growth, addressing growing concerns over air hygiene. The company emphasized their commitment to sustainability by manufacturing these materials with recycled fibers. This development caters to the rising demand for efficient and eco-friendly HVAC solutions in residential and commercial spaces.
